Md Shafiqur Rahman is a Research Associate in genetic epidemiology working on the polygenic prediction of age-related neurological outcomes. He studied Speech and Language Therapy (BSc.) at the University of Dhaka (Dhaka, Bangladesh). After that, he studied Public Health Epidemiology (MSc.) at Karolinska Institute (Stockholm, Sweden). He worked as a research assistant for one and a half years in the Dept. of Public Health Sciences and Dept. of Neurogenetics at Karolinska Institute. In 2018, he moved to London and completed PhD training in genetic epidemiology from King’s College London. His doctoral project investigated Omics (genomics and glycomics) in Chronic Widespread Pain using large scale data sets. His current research interests centre around understanding causal mechanisms underlying psychiatric and neurological conditions, early risk stratification of patients and drug repurposing.
